Septic Arthritis is inflammation of joint that is caused by an infection and so is also called as Infectious Arthritis. This infection can be caused by germs that travel in our bloodstream through another part of our body. It can also be caused by bacterial infection from an open wound or from a surgical procedure such as Knee Surgery.
Any joint can be affected by septic arthritis but it is mostly common in the knees and hips. And more than one joint can be affected at a time....
